Introduction to Photovoltaic Inverters
Photovoltaic (PV) inverters are the beating heart of any solar energy system. Think of them as translators – they convert the raw DC electricity generated by solar panels into usable AC electricity for homes, businesses, and the grid. Without these devices, solar power would remain trapped in panels, unable to light up our world.

Core Functions of Solar Inverters
- DC-to-AC Conversion: The primary job, achieving 95-99% efficiency in modern models
- Power Optimization: Maximizes energy harvest through MPPT (Maximum Power Point Tracking)
- Grid Synchronization: Matches voltage and frequency with utility grids
- Safety Monitoring: Detects electrical faults and isolates systems during outages

Advanced Features in Modern Inverters
Smart Grid Integration
Today's inverters act like traffic controllers for electricity. They can:
- Feed excess power back to the grid
- Adjust output based on grid demands
- Support bidirectional flow for vehicle-to-grid (V2G) systems

Inverter Type | Efficiency | Typical Use Case |
---|---|---|
String Inverters | 97% | Residential rooftops |
Microinverters | 96.5% | Shaded installations |
Central Inverters | 98.5% | Utility-scale plants |
Choosing the Right Inverter: Key Considerations
Don't just pick the shini model! Ask these questions:
- What's your system size? (5kW needs different hardware than 5MW)
- Any shading issues? Microinverters might outperform string types here
- Planning battery storage later? Go hybrid-ready

Solar Inverter Maintenance: Easier Than You Think
Modern units require minimal upkeep. Just:
- Keep vents dust-free
- Check LED status monthly
- Schedule professional inspections every 3-5 years
Most quality inverters now come with 10-12 year warranties, outlasting many solar panels themselves.
FAQs: Your Top Questions Answered
Do inverters work during blackouts?
Only if paired with batteries – standard grid-tied models shut down for safety.
How long do they typically last?
Most operate efficiently for 12-15 years, though some industrial models exceed 20.
Can I expand my system later?
Yes, but ensure your inverter has 20-30% extra capacity from day one.
